SUF Gym isn’t just about pushing weights, it’s about personal transformation, confidence, and community. They bring together gym training + MMA in a space where people feel seen, supported, and empowered to exceed their fitness goals.
When they approached me, SUF Gym wanted a brand identity that matched their mission: training as personal as the journey, offering expert guidance, while being welcoming to all, not just the already fit.
Brand refresh for SUF Gym & MMA Academy: making personal training welcoming, bold, and deeply connected to its members.
What I did:
Market Research & Positioning: Scoped what gym + MMA branding in the region was doing — mapped what was resonating emotionally, what felt intimidating, what felt inspiring.
Visual & Brand Refresh: Refined the typography, logo, and visual assets to balance strength & warmth; loud where it needs to assert, soft where it invites.
Digital + Marketing Assets: Designed website refresh, motion graphics, and branding materials that reflect consistency and personality.
